  ? finisar corporation C 21 - march - 2016 rev. b3 page 1 product specification 3 0 0m , 1 0x10 .3 g b e c fp 2 optical transceiver module ftlc 8221 rfnm product features ? hot - pluggable cfp 2 form factor ? supports 103.1gb/s aggregate bit rate ? power dissipation < 4 w ? rohs - 6 compliant (lead - free) ? commercial case temper ature range of 0 c to 7 0 c ? single 3.3v power supply ? maximum link length of 3 00m on om3 multimode fiber (m mf) ? uncooled 10x10gb/s 850nm transmitter ? 10x sfi limiting electrical interface ? single mpo24 receptacle ? mdio management interface ? tx/rx optical power monitoring functionality applications ? 10x 10gbase - sr ethernet ? 2x 40gbase - sr4 ethernet ? 100g base - sr10 ethernet finisars ftlc 8221 rfnm 10 x10.3 g b e c fp 2 transceiver modules are designed for fan - out applications interconnecting to either ten 10gbase - sr sfp+ or xfp modules, or to two 40gbase - sr4 qsfp+ or cfp modules over up to 300 meters of multimode fiber. they can also be used for 100g ethernet links. they are compliant with the cfp 2 msa 1 , with ieee 802.3ae 10gbase - sr 2 and sfi per sff - 843 1 5 . digital diagnostic s functions are available via the mdio interf ace as specified by finisar application note an - 2 1 xx 5 . the transceiver is rohs - 6 compliant and lead - free per directive 20 11 / 6 5/e u 3 , and finisar application note an - 2038 4 . for a 100m otu4/100g ethernet compliant product, see ftlc8221scnm. product selection ftlc 8221 rfnm r : ethernet maximum bit rate (1 0.3 gb/s per lane ) f : 10x10g parallel optics , 10g ethernet compliant n: flat top module (no heat sink) m : mpo receptacle

FTLC8221RFNM product specification C march 2016 ? finisar corporation C 21 - march - 2016 rev. b3 page 4 ii. absolute maximum ratings module performance is not guaranteed beyond the operating range (see section vi). exceeding the limits below may damage the transceiver module permanently. parameter symbol min typ max unit ref. maximum supply voltage vcc - 0.5 4.0 v storage temperature t s - 40 85 ? c case operating temperature t op 0 7 0 ? c relative humidity rh 15 8 5 % 1 receiver damage threshold , per lane p rdmg 5 .5 dbm notes : 1. non - condensing. i ii . electrical characteristics ( eol, t op = 0 to 7 0 ? cc = 3. 13 to 3.4 7 volts) parameter symbol min typ max unit ref. supply voltage vcc 3.13 3.47 v supply current icc 1.15 ma module total power p 4.0 w 1 transmitter (per lane) ? 10.3125 10.3125 gb/s ? 120 1200 mvpp 3 receiver (per lane) ? 10.3125 10.3125 gb/s ? 300 800 mvpp 4 output transition time, 20% to 80% 28 ps 5 power supply ripple tolerance psr per cfp msa 1 mvpp notes : 1. maximum total power value is specified across the full temperature and voltage range. 2. +/ - 100ppm at 10.3125 gb/s 3. after internal ac coupling. self - biasing 100 ? differential input. 4. ac coupled with 100 ? differential output impedance . limiting output . 5. 20 C 80 % . measured with module compliance test board and oma test pattern. use of four 1s and four 0s in sequence in the prbs^9 is an acceptable alternative. sff - 8431 rev 4.1 ftlc 8221 rfnm clocking signals clock name status i/o value refclk not required i not required; terminated internally.
FTLC8221RFNM product specification C march 2016 ? finisar corporation C 21 - march - 2016 rev. b3 page 5 i v. optical characteristics ( eol, t op = 0 to 7 0 ? cc = 3. 13 to 3.4 7 volts ) parameter symbol min typ max unit ref. transmitter (per lane) ? signaling speed per lane 10.3125 10.3125 gbd 1 center wavelength 840 860 nm rms spectral width sw 0.4 5 nm average launch power per lane txp x - 3 +0.5 dbm 2 transmit oma per lane txoma - 2.5 dbm 3 tdp per lane tdp 3. 9 dbm optical extinction ratio er 3.0 db optical return loss tolerance orl 12 db encircled flux flx > 86% at 19 um < 30% at 4.5 um dbm average launch power of off transmitter, per lane - 30 dbm relative intensity noise rin - 128 db/hz 4 transmitter eye mask definition {x1, x2, x3, y1, y2, y3} 0.2 5 , 0. 40 , 0.4 5 , 0.2 5 , 0. 28 , 0.4 0 receiver (per lane) ? signaling speed per lane 10.3125 10.3125 gbd 5 center wavelength 840 860 nm maximum input power per lane rxp max +0.5 dbm stressed receiver sensitivity (oma) per lane srs - 7.5 dbm 6 back to back receiver sensitivity (oma) per lane rxsens - 11.1 dbm 7 receiver reflectance rfl - 12 db los de - assert los d - 1 1 dbm los assert los a - 30 - 1 4 dbm los hysteresis 0.5 db notes : 1. transmitter consists of 1 0 lasers ope rating at a maximum rate of 1 0.3125 gb/s each. 2. average launch power (min) is informative and not the principal indicator of signal strength. 3. p er the ieee 802.3ae triple trade - off table 52.8. 4. rin is scaled by 10*log (10 /4) to maintain snr outside of transmitter. 5. receiver consists of 1 0 photodetectors operating at a maximum rate of 10.3125 gb/s each. 6. per ieee 802.3ae . 7. informative value only. measured with worst - case er; ber<10 - 12 ; 2 31 C 1 prbs .
FTLC8221RFNM product specification C march 2016 ? finisar corporation C 21 - march - 2016 rev. b3 page 6 v. general specifications parameter symbol min typ max units ref. bit rate (all lanes combined) br 103.1 103.1 gb/s 1 bit error ratio ber 10 - 12 2 maximum supported distances fiber type om2 mmf lmax1 82 m om3 mmf lmax 2 3 00 m notes : 1. each lane s upports 10gbase - sr per ieee 802.3 ae . 2. tested with a 2 31 C 1 prbs vi. environmental specifications finisar ftlc 8221 cfp2 transceivers have an operating case temperature range of 0 c to +7 0 c . parameter symbol min typ max units ref. case operating temperature t op 0 7 0 c storage temperature t sto - 40 85 c v i i. regulatory compliance finisar ftlc 8221 cfp 2 transceivers are class 1 laser eye safety compliant per iec 60825 - 1. they are certified per the following standards: feature agency standard certificate number laser eye safety fda/cdrh cdrh 21 cfr 1040 and laser notice 50 921076 laser eye safety tv en 60950 - 1: 2006+a11 en 60825 - 1: 2007 en 60825 - 2: 2004+a1+a2 r 72130387 electrical safety tv en 60950 r 72130387 electrical safety ul/csa class 3862.13 class 3862.93 190993 - 2375840 copies of the referenced certificates are available at finisar corporation upon request.
